AUSTRALIAN CABLES.

INTERRUPTION OF THE CABLE A CAUTION TO SWEEP PROMOTERS. A NEW STANDARD OF POLITICIANS. | Pee Peess Association.] Sydxey, January 29. The Port Darwin line is interupted be- j tween Charlotte and Alice Springs, Alexander, promoter of the ' Gala ' consultations, was sentenced to three months for conduotmg a swe6p oc the Anniversary Handicap. Notice of appeul was given. This Day. The annual meeting of the Local Option League passed a motion condeming the delay of the passage of Local Option legislation, and urging the return to Parliament of men of integrity, and whose (names are uutarnished by immorality and drunkeunessj The interruption of telegraph communication between the Alice Springs and Charlotte Waters was caused by heavy rain in Central Australia. The West Australian route is working intermittently. The Herald, commenting on the breaks, says it strengthens the case for the constrnction of the Pacific cable. The Marine Board has suspended the certificate of the Captain of the schooner Eillan Donan for three months, from the ; time of the wreck. Melbouene, January 29. The steamer Garrawonga , from Lou- ' don, picked up three natives in the last stage of starvation, a hundred and fifty miles south-east of Sierra Leone. They had been blown off the African coast with four others, who died of starvation. The watchman of the lighter turned up to-day, and stated that ne had been ill and went up the town, and that the lighter had been cut adrift during his absence. The explanation is considered unsatisfactory, and the man has been dismissed.
